Alongside Ndoye: Nottingham Forest starting talks to sign £65k-p/w winger

Nottingham Forest are now “starting” talks to sign an “incredible” forward, who could be in line to join alongside Bologna’s Dan Ndoye, according to reporter John Percy.

Nottingham Forest closing in on Ndoye's signature

With Anthony Elanga joining Newcastle United, one of Nuno Espirito Santo’s most important tasks this summer was to bring in a new winger, and Fabrizio Romano has revealed a deal is now in place for Ndoye, with the Bologna forward set to travel to England for a medical very soon.

Given that Elanga is well-known for being a “constant direct threat”, it was important for Nuno to bring in a replacement also capable of driving at opposition defences, and the Swiss winger ranks in the 92nd percentile for progressive carries per 90 over the past year.

Despite the deal for Ndoye recently edging closer to completion, the Tricky Trees remain interested in signing another new winger this summer, and Nuno is now targeting a reunion with one of his former players…

That is according to Percy, who recently reported that Nottingham Forest are now “starting” talks with Fulham over a potential deal for Adama Traore, with the winger emerging as a serious target, given that Nuno is prioritising the additions of new wide men.

Saha: 'Ganguly pushed me to play and finish with Bengal'

Wicketkeeper says he had originally planned to retire before the start of this season

Shashank Kishore06-Nov-2024

Sourav Ganguly played a key role in convincing Wriddhiman Saha into playing another Ranji season•PTI

Wriddhiman Saha had already made up his mind to retire from cricket when he casually went to the Eden Gardens this June. But after he returned from a meeting meant to amicably resolve differences with certain factions within the Cricket Association of Bengal (CAB), which had led to his departure to Tripura for two seasons, Saha had a change of mind.The reason: Sourav Ganguly. The former India captain had convinced Saha to stay on so that he could end his career with Bengal. And so, Saha, who has had plenty of taping around his fingers and strapping around his hamstring and pain-relief patches on his back, decided to continue with the team’s physio on speed dial to be able to help him fight through another season.”You can say it was because of emotional attachment,” he says as he sits down for a chat on the opening day of Bengal’s fourth-round Ranji fixture against Karnataka in Bengaluru. “I wasn’t going to play this year but Sourav Ganguly and my wife pushed me to play and finish with Bengal after two seasons with Tripura.”When he gave his nod to play, Saha made it clear he won’t be available for the white-ball leg of the domestic season. He knew he wouldn’t last the rigours of another full season. It was also partly influenced by his desire to have his spot taken by someone else, because he’d already informed his previous IPL franchise, Gujarat Titans, he wasn’t going to play in the tournament anymore.As it turns out, one of the direct beneficiaries of Saha’s exit (from when he moved to Tripura) has been Abishek Porel, who has flourished so much over the past year across formats that Delhi Capitals considered him worthy of being retained. For Saha, a mentor to the young group of wicketkeepers across the country, there couldn’t have been a better validation.”I’ve been pushing myself for the last year. But because of my body condition and injuries, I won’t be able to play for the full season,” he says. “That’s why I chose the most vital format – Ranji Trophy. It will be tough [to carry on] but I will play and hopefully we qualify. If we do, I will play till the end of the season, else I’ll finish off at Eden Gardens.”Related

Saha laughs when asked if the decision to contemplate retirement was tough. “It was very easy,” he replies spontaneously. “I was already prepared that I won’t play this year. But when my wife and Sourav Ganguly pushed me, I couldn’t refuse.”Still considered among the best wicketkeepers in India, perhaps even around the world, Saha seems at peace with his decision. He’s fully happy with the way his career has panned out, even though his career coincided at different times with two mavericks: MS Dhoni in the early years and Rishabh Pant in the later. Has he ever considered himself unlucky?”No, I don’t think so,” he says. “There are so many of them who didn’t play despite toiling so hard. Amol Muzumdar, Padmakar Shivalkar sir. I feel fortunate and proud to have played 40 Tests for India.”Wriddhiman Saha behind the stumps: acrobatic and safe•BCCI

As he looks ahead, Saha is open to opportunities in coaching and mentoring. He’s clear the first rights will be with Bengal. “Not yet [thought of the immediate future], but if I get an offer from another state or Bengal, I will think about it,” he laughs. “If not, family life (laughs). I have been playing cricket since childhood. I haven’t done anything else. I want to share as much knowledge as I have in cricket. I’ve already started doing that at a couple of academies back home.”Saha ended his Test career with 1353 runs in 56 innings at an average of 29.41, with three centuries and six half-centuries. Arguably, his finest moment on home turf when he hit unbeaten half-centuries in both innings to help India beat New Zealand in 2016. Saha admits “maybe I could’ve done more” with the bat, but insists his career graph was largely a reflection of his emphasis on being a wicketkeeper first and a batter next.”When I started, I was a wicketkeeper. I knew I could never be as good as Sachin Tendulkar, Sourav Ganguly, Rahul Dravid, Virender Sehwag, VVS Laxman and Virat Kohli,” he says. “I wanted to earn a name in what I did from childhood – that’s why I put more emphasis on wicketkeeping.”He grew up working with Kiran More, Saba Karim and Deep Dasgupta. Chats with Dhoni over the years, and occasional interactions with Adam Gilchrist and Ian Healy fueled his pursuits of being his best version. As a seasoned professional, Saha says he’s happy to chat with young keepers and help them.”I’ve spoken to keepers from the women’s team, we keep talking to each other,” he says. “Last IPL, Dhruv Jurel spoke to me. Rishabh [Pant] has done it all along when we played together. The understanding was good, he used to share his experiences, I used to give him as much input as possible.”As Saha reflects on his career, he’s happy he continued to play for three more years despite being told in late 2021 by then coach Rahul Dravid that the Indian team were moving on from him.”That door got closed, but I knew domestic, and IPL was still there,” he says. “It wasn’t like I got demoralised because of that. I’ve played now for three-four years since that. Why did I start playing? Because I like it. Last year, I’d stopped liking the game and planned to leave. After this season, I’m moving on.”Hopefully we can make the final. If not, I’ll finish off at Eden Gardens.”

Rahul to open in Adelaide, Rohit will bat in the middle order

India captain was all praise for Washington Sundar but he also said he sees Ashwin and Jadeja “playing a huge role in the rest of the series”

Alagappan Muthu05-Dec-20244:56

Rohit: ‘Rahul probably deserves the opening slot at this point in time’

Rohit Sharma, who has usually opened the batting for India in Test cricket since 2019, has confirmed that he will be moving down the order for the day-night Test match against Australia in Adelaide. His reasoning suggested it might be a temporary measure, but it is clear that KL Rahul and Yashasvi Jaiswal have done too well as an opening pair, adding 201 in the second innings of the Perth Test to set up India’s victory, to be separated immediately. That means even though Rohit is the captain of the side, he needs to make an adjustment and play out of position.”How I came to that decision of batting down the order is because we want results, we want success,” Rohit said on Thursday. “And those two guys at the top – just looking at this one Test match – they batted brilliantly. I was at home with my newborn in my arms and I was watching how KL batted. It was brilliant to watch, to be honest.”And I felt that there’s no need to change that now. Maybe in the future things will be different, I don’t know. So based on what has happened and what KL has shown outside of India, he probably deserves that place at this point.Related

“It is something that has given us success in the first Test. To have that big partnership with Jaiswal on the other side probably won us the Test.”Rahul might not have got a century but he was excellent across both innings in Perth. Jaiswal did get a century, bouncing back from a duck in the first innings, and was feeling so good in the middle that he was happy to point out that Mitchell Starc was coming on too slowly and Nathan Lyon might be a legend but was getting old. India made 487 for 6 declared and won by 295 runs.”When you come to a place like Perth and you get 500-odd runs, it’s a massive tick in the box,” Rohit said. “What I saw from the outside looked brilliant and there was no need to change anything.”KL Rahul and Yashasvi Jaiswal put up 201 in the second innings in Perth•AFP/Getty Images

Just as he was winding up his answer, Rohit offered a window into how the team wants to operate whether they win, lose or draw. They do not seem to bow to stature as much as they have previously been perceived to. Here, for example, the captain was giving up his spot to Rahul, who played only one of the three matches in their previous Test series.”It was actually pretty simple for me,” Rohit said. “Personally, not easy, but for the team, it made a lot of sense.”Team-first is the philosophy that fuelled India into picking the XI they played with in Perth because it meant leaving two men with a combined 800-plus Test wickets out.”It’s always hard to leave out experienced players like [Ravindra] Jadeja and [R] Ashwin. But I think the decision was made for whatever was best for the team at that particular time.”Rohit on R Ashwin and Ravindra Jadeja: “I certainly see them playing a huge role in the rest of the series”•AFP/Getty Images

In Canberra, India’s assistant coach Abhishek Nayar spoke highly of the two spinners for taking the decision well. Ashwin made his way onto the field just as his replacement Washington Sundar was about to begin his spell and, having tended to his duties as 12th man, he made sure to go up to the bowler for a quick chat before leaving the field.It was 37°C on the eve of the match and the Adelaide pitch was kept under the covers to protect it from the heat. Chances of thundershowers that were forecast for the first day have also receded and the mercury is set to keep soaring, which could possibly bring spin into the picture even with the pink ball. Ashwin was seen working on his batting with head coach Gautam Gambhir sending him throwdowns.”I certainly see them playing a huge role in the rest of the series,” Rohit said about Ashwin and Jadeja, “because what they bring to the table can never be written off.” And about Washington, he said, “We have seen what he can do with the ball, with the bat. He’s got a solid technique to play anywhere in the world. And when such guys are in the team, you get confidence. And with Washy especially, now I just hope that he stays away from injury and doesn’t get injured. Because a player like him is always valuable to our squad. [He] gives us that balance, that depth that a team always requires. So with Washy, I can see his graph from here going up only.”Rohit talked up the young batters in his side too. He was asked to explain how Jaiswal, Shubman Gill and Rishabh Pant have been able to find success overseas very early in their careers.”The youngsters nowadays are fearless. They don’t carry any baggage. Jaiswal, Gill, Pant – these are the cricketers of a different generation,” Rohit said. “When we had come to Australia for the first time, the only thing in our minds used to be how to score runs. We would put extra pressure on ourselves. But every generation is different. Today’s players are bold and fearless, and perhaps this is working in their favour.”Whenever I talk to them, they have only one thing in their mind: how to win the match. They don’t think of how I would score a hundred or a double-hundred. When you start thinking like that, the individual performances take care of themselves. Because if you have to win, you will have to perform – and that happens automatically. If your primary focus is how to win matches, series, tournaments, then the big runs these guys make that is secondary.”If they are not able to contribute with the bat, they think what they can do in fielding, or bowling. So the guys these days think like this, which is a very, very good thing. I don’t know if someone talks to them about it, tells them. But this is their natural mindset when they come for a tour – their mindset is how to win the match.”

ANÁLISE: Flamengo vê recorde de Gabigol, mas expõe seus erros e amarga empate diante do Racing na Libertadores

MatériaMais Notícias

O roteiro parecia pronto: iria incluir Gabigol, recorde e uma vitória mágica no Estádio El Cilindro. Mas, em vez disso, a amargura entrou em cena na forma como o Flamengo cedeu ao Racing o empate em 1 a 1 na quinta-feira (4). As oscilações do Rubro-Negro foram escancaradas no duelo válido pela terceira rodada do Grupo A da Copa Libertadores.

Após terem tomado as rédeas da partida, os comandados de Jorge Sampaoli viram os donos da casa aproveitarem os espaços e arrancarem um empate que não trouxe nada a comemorar. Estes pontos podem custar caro a um Flamengo que ainda anseia por evolução.

A equipe lidou com um cenário desafiador no início. O jogo era muito picotado, e os rubro-negros pareciam encaixotados na marcação. Cabia a Everton Ribeiro ser a válvula de escape, trabalhando a bola e procurando investidas em especial com Ayrton Lucas.

Quando Hauche abuscou da violência e deixou o Racing com um a menos, o Rubro-Negro foi se impondo mais. Ayrton Lucas e Pulgar se apresentaram de vez e a bola começou a se aproximar de Pedro e Gabigol. O camisa 9 estava longe de seus melhores dias. Gabigol chegou a receber um passe açucarado mas, diante do gol escancarado, finalizou para fora.

Só em momento de oportunismo, seu gol de número 30 na Copa Libertadores aconteceu em um lance curiosíssimo. A cobrança de falta de Erick Pulgar veio mansamente até seus pés. O camisa 10 deixou a marcação de lado, a bola quicou e ele, de canela, mandou para a rede. Foi o fim de sua seca com a bola rolando. O jejum durava desde 15 de fevereiro, contra o Volta Redonda, pelo Estadual.

– Isso aí são coisas de vocês. Para mim, gol é gol. Gol de pênalti, gol de falta, gol de escanteio, gol de bunda, gol com a perna esquerda, gol com a perna direita. Gol é gol. Feliz em ajudar a equipe, uma pena que não foi com a vitória. Isso era mais importante – disse, em entrevista à Conmebol.

Só que o ritmo rubro-negro do fim do primeiro tempo não foi retomado na volta do intervalo. O Flamengo, mesmo com um a mais, perdia o rumo, atuava de maneira burocrática e se arriscava demais. Houve recuos em regiões perigosas que fizeram Santos sair da meta de maneira atabalhoada. O técnico Jorge Sampaoli lançou Arrascaeta e Bruno Henrique (ambos ainda recuperando seu ritmo de jogo) aos 19 minutos, deixando o quarteto de 2019 junto em campo por alguns minutos. Posteriormente, Everton Ribeiro deu lugar a Everton Cebolinha.

O Flamengo, no entanto, vinha desandando naquele momento. A defesa se mostrava vulnerável e dava brechas para o Racing avançar. Até um pisão afobado em uma dividida culminar na expulsão de Wesley e em uma falta frontal. A equipe argentina empatou em um golaço de Oroz.

Ficaram escancarados erros na equipe de Jorge Sampaoli. O Flamengo batia cabeça e surgiam buracos para ataques adversários. Saliadarre era o mais perigoso, exigia o goleiro Santos e chegou a carimbar a trave em uma finalização. Na base do “abafa”, Gabigol tentou engatar jogada com Bruno Henrique, mas seu passe saiu errado. O camisa 10 ainda viu um lançamento de Arrascaeta ficar diante dos seus pés, mas ela passou, em chance na qual Thiago Maia encheu o pé e mandou no travessão.

Por mais que o Rubro-Negro tenha “protagonizado” a partida, como diz Jorge Sampaoli, fica claro que a equipe tem ainda a ajustar. Cabe ao Flamengo encontrar a melhor forma de evitar que o meio fique engessado e que a ansiedade frustre os planos rubro-negros na Copa Libertadores. Noites promissoras como a da última quinta-feira (4) não podem deixar como última lembrança a sensação de desperdício.

Santos e Palmeiras empatam sem gols em jogo de baixa qualidade técnica no Brasileirão

MatériaMais Notícias

Em jogo de pouca qualidade, Santos e Palmeiras empataram em 0 a 0, neste sábado, na Vila Belmiro, pela sétima rodada do Brasileirão. Enquanto o Alvinegro se esforçou mais por neutralizar o adversário do que propriamente jogar, o Verdão não esteve em seus melhores dias juntamente com seus craques e praticamente não ofereceu perigo ao rival. Com isso, o time de Abel Ferreira se distância da liderança e Peixe não sobe na tabela.

Peixe começa pressionando, e Verdão sente a dificuldade imposta

O Santos começou o jogo com uma estratégia bem clara de limitar qualquer chance de o Palmeiras utilizar de suas virtudes para levar vantagem na Vila. A pressão na primeira marcação e a verticalidade nas jogadas foram as grandes sacadas do time da casa, que conseguia impedia a saída do rival e ainda buscar colocar perigo nas investidas. Apesar disso, a grande chance dos primeiros minutos foi do Alviverde, que chegou com Gabriel Menino mandando um chute de três dedos na trave de João Paulo.

Santos mantém a pegada, e Palmeiras segue “irreconhecível”

Quem pensou que o Peixe fosse diminuir a intensidade depois da imposição na primeira parte do jogo se enganou. A equipe de Odair Hellmann manteve sua pegada e dificultou ao máximo a vida palmeirense. Raphael Veiga, por exemplo, quase não apareceu no jogo e Dudu, que buscou a posse por muitas vezes, conseguia driblar apenas no meio-campo. Gabriel Menino novamente assustou em chute de longe, mas foi o Alvinegro que encerrou a primeira etapa colocando pressão e fazendo Weverton trabalhar algumas vezes. O placar, porém, ficou no 0 a 0.

Peixe recua, Palmeiras melhora, mas placar segue 0 a 0

Na volta do intervalo, o Verdão conseguiu mudar sua postura e teve mais a posse de bola em seu campo de ataque. Ao mesmo tempo, o Santos deixou de impor a intensidade que teve na primeira etapa. Agora, eram os donos da casa que estavam sem saída, enquanto os visitantes tinham quase o campo inteiro para trocarem passes. O problema é que as tomadas de decisão alviverdes eram quase sempre erradas. Dudu errou muitas tentativas de drible, Rony estava mal e foi substituído por Endrick, enquanto Veiga quase não apareceu no jogo. 0 a 0 era justíssimo.

Times mexem na formação, mas não mexem no placar

Sem muitas alterações no panorama do jogo e com as duas equipes com muitas dificuldades para conseguir uma jogada de ataque, os técnicos tentaram mudar as peças para buscar alguma mexida na distribuição delas, mas o que se viu foi mais do mesmo, ou seja, um segundo tempo de qualidade técnica baixíssima. Dessa forma, não tinha outro jeito senão o jogo terminar empatado em 0 a 0.

E agora?

Com o resultado, Santos e Palmeiras levam um ponto para a conta. Enquanto o Verdão vai a 15 pontos e permanece na vice-liderança do Brasileirão, o Peixe vai 11 e está na 11ª colocação. Na próxima rodada do campeonato, o Alviverde vai até Belo Horizonte para enfrentar o Atlético-MG, já o Alvinegro enfrenta o Bragantino, fora de casa. Antes disso, ambos têm compromisso continental: o Palmeiras enfrenta o Cerro Porteño-PAR pela Libertadores, e o Santos pega o Audax Italiano-CHI. Os dois jogarão fora do país.
